Kapitel 9. Fortgeschrittenes SQL
Diese Arbeit wurde mithilfe von KI übersetzt. Wir freuen uns über dein Feedback und deine Kommentare: translation-feedback@oreilly.com
Zwar kannst du mit den mächtigen SQL-Anweisungen, die in Kapitel 8 behandelt werden, eine Menge erreichen, aber du kratzt nur an der Oberfläche dessen, was du mit komplexeren Abfragen in Trino erreichen kannst. In diesem Kapitel geht es um fortgeschrittenere Funktionen, wie Funktionen, Operatoren und andere Features.
Funktionen und Operatoren Einführung
Bisher hast du die Grundlagen kennengelernt, darunter Kataloge, Schemata, Tabellen, Datentypen und verschiedene SQL-Anweisungen. Dieses Wissen ist nützlich, wenn du Daten aus einer oder mehreren Tabellen in einem oder mehreren Katalogen in Trino abfragen willst. In den Beispielen haben wir uns vor allem darauf konzentriert, Abfragen zu schreiben, die Daten aus den verschiedenen Attributen oder Spalten einer Tabelle verwenden.
Es gibt SQL-Funktionen und Operatoren, die komplexere und umfassendere SQL-Abfragen ermöglichen. In diesem Kapitel konzentrieren wir uns auf die von Trino unterstützten Funktionen und Operatoren und geben Beispiele für ihre Verwendung.
Funktionen und Operatoren in SQL sind intern gleichwertig. Funktionen verwenden im Allgemeinen die Syntaxform function_name
(function_arg1
, ...) und Operatoren verwenden eine andere Syntax, ähnlich wie Operatoren in Programmiersprachen und in der Mathematik. Operatoren sind eine syntaktische Abkürzung und Verbesserung ...
Get Trino: Der endgültige Leitfaden, 2. Auflage now with the O’Reilly learning platform.
O’Reilly members experience books, live events, courses curated by job role, and more from O’Reilly and nearly 200 top publishers.